Can carbonated drinks cause heartburn?

Can carbonated drinks cause heartburn? Carbonation causes the esophagus to become more acidic. Whether caffeinated or caffeine-free, it doesn’t matter. Carbonated drinks and sodas make nighttime heartburn symptoms much more likely.

Why do carbonated drinks give me heartburn? “Carbonated beverages cause gastric distension,” Mausner says. And if your stomach is distended, this increases pressure on the esophageal sphincter, promoting reflux.” He tells WebMD that people with heartburn may be wise to steer clear of pop and other carbonated beverages.

Are sparkling drinks bad for acid reflux? Background: Carbonated beverages have unique properties that may potentially exacerbate gastro-oesophageal reflux disease (GERD), such as high acidity and carbonation. Cessation of carbonated beverage consumption is commonly recommended as part of lifestyle modifications for patients with GERD.

Where does carbon in the atmosphere go? Where do our carbon dioxide emissions go? Only about 50 percent of the CO2 from human emissions remains in the atmosphere. The remainder is approximately equally split between uptake into the land biosphere and into the ocean.

Why are carbon fiber bikes so popular?

Ride quality has long been a claimed benefit of carbon frames. Carbon can be engineered to be stiff in certain directions and compliant in other directions. This means a carbon frame can be comfortable over bumps and rough roads while simultaneously being stiff enough in key areas for efficiency.

How does vinegar and baking soda make carbon dioxide?

When vinegar and baking soda are first mixed together, hydrogen ions in the vinegar react with the sodium and bicarbonate ions in the baking soda. … The carbonic acid formed as a result of the first reaction immediately begins to decompose into water and carbon dioxide gas.

Why is calcium carbonate used in paint?

Ground calcium carbonate (GCC) is commonly used in a number of paint and coating applications. It is used as an extender, an agent to either reduce or enhance gloss, an extender / spacer for titanium dioxide, a rheology modifier and as a paint and coating additive to densify the product.

Which is more dangerous carbon dioxide or carbon monoxide?

At 80,000 ppm, CO2 can be life-threatening. As a reference, OSHA (Occupational Safety and Health Administration) has set a CO2 permissible exposure limit (PEL) of 5,000 ppm over an eight-hour period and 30,000 ppm over a 10-minute period. Carbon monoxide is a far more dangerous gas.

How much carbon dioxide is released each year?

The U.S. Energy Information Administration estimates that in 2019, the United States emitted 5.1 billion metric tons of energy-related carbon dioxide, while the global emissions of energy-related carbon dioxide totaled 33.1 billion metric tons.

How long can carbon monoxide stay in your blood?

The half-life of carboxyhemoglobin in fresh air is approximately 4 hours. To completely flush the carbon monoxide from the body requires several hours, valuable time when additional damage can occur.

How does temperature affect carbonation in soda?

Carbonated drinks tend to lose their fizz at higher temperatures because the loss of carbon dioxide in liquids is increased as temperature is raised. This can be explained by the fact that when carbonated liquids are exposed to high temperatures, the solubility of gases in them is decreased.

What material is carbon fibre made of?

About 90% of the carbon fibers produced are made from polyacrylonitrile (PAN). The remaining 10% are made from rayon or petroleum pitch. All of these materials are organic polymers, characterized by long strings of molecules bound together by carbon atoms.
